    Cars, SUVs, and Trucks With the Best Fuel Economy

    These mpg figures are based on CR's extensive fuel-economy tests

    person pumping gas at ATC with a Mazda2 car Photo: John Powers/Consumer Reports

    Fuel economy is a key factor in the operating costs for vehicles. A small difference in the overall miles-per-gallon rating can add up to big bucks over years of ownership.

    CR conducts extensive fuel-economy tests on every model we purchase to make sure our members have the essential data needed to make informed purchase decisions.

    The lists below highlight the vehicles by category that got the best fuel economy in Consumer Reports’ latest tests.

    Rather than display every tested vehicle here, we have selected miles-per-gallon cutoffs that are relative to each category. For example, a vehicle that gets 21 mpg wouldn’t be a standout among wagons, but it would be among the highest in the midsized SUV or minivan category.
